I just went to an event that had hanging lanterns going for two hours, so now I have thoughts about what this means for Kankagari (hanging lantern watching), the Rengoku family meditative practice that results in yellow and red hair.


As a reminder, this information was revealed in the Taisho Secrets distributed at the first showings of Mugen Ressha in October of 2020. You can read all of them here, but here is just the translation of the Kankagari section:
Why do the men in the Rengoku family have hair like that?
The Rengoku family has long since had a practice called “Kankagari.” For the duration of their pregnancies, every seven days the wives will spend two hours gazing at a large flaming torch. This seems to be what causes the men in the family to have flame colored hair. That being said, it seems that it’s normally bad for a pregnant woman’s health to stare at large flames, so please don’t attempt this.
A few considerations, based on tonight's observation:
First consideration: The source of the fire.
Although the Taisho Secrets do not elaborate on this, many real life fire-related ceremonies use fire from a special source. This could add some depth to a fic that makes use of Kankagari. (As a reminder, the consensus among the Japanese fandom is that Kankagari is a meditative practice that only exists in the world of Kimetsu no Yaiba, so go set your heart ablaze and go wild. But as a side note, clacking sparks on someone's back before they embark on certain undertakings does have real life basis.)
First consideration: Smoke.
If writing Kankagari into a fic, you probably want to consider whether they're sitting outside, sitting inside and watching a hanging lantern outside, or sitting in a somehow very well ventilated room with a fireproof floor. If it's (more likely) outside, you'll want to consider the weather and the direction of the wind.
Third consideration: Fires need tending.
Over the course of two hours, there was a priest fussing about the lantern every five minutes or so. Aside from adding lots and lots of pre-chopped wood and stoking the fire to keep it going, he also was constantly wetting down the fallen, flaming wood to snuff it out. There was a hole dug under each lantern to catch most (but not all) of these often very big chunks, and the priest used a soaking wet broom made of straw and bamboo to put out those fires that fell.
This means that when an expectant Rengoku mother is practicing this meditation, she either:
--does this all herself, or
--someone else accompanies her for the duration of the two hours.
Perhaps centuries of Rengoku mothers had their relatives come help them with this, but as my own spot of input, yeah, I could see Shinjuro having done this for Ruka whenever his work allowed it. I could also see her very strong young son Kyojuro helping on a regular basis.
